VanKiller 322 Posted December 12, 2007 Report Share Posted December 12, 2007 Anything you can pay for is possible my friend, but first off, I think your going to be looking at a threaded barrel on the RPK, and a press barrel on the Saiga. The second problem I would have doing the conversion, is the RPK barrel never seemed to give an advantage in accuracy. The heavier barrel seemed to be built to hold up under prolonged firing and heat issues, rather than serving as a heavy target barrel. I've put the barrels on earlier AK's, and never got an increase in accuracy, but it is a definite increase in way cool look........ Quote Link to post Share on other sites
